Released in 1995, Se7en follows two homicide detectives—a retiring veteran (Morgan Freeman) and a brash newcomer (Brad Pitt)—as they track a meticulous serial killer who uses the seven deadly sins as his motifs.
The film is renowned for its dark, oppressive atmosphere, its shocking narrative twists, and its unflinching depiction of urban decay. It was a massive critical and commercial success, grossing over $327 million worldwide against a modest budget of $33–34 million.
